Vaporooter Treatment for Tree Root Blockages in Cheltenham

Tree roots are one of the leading causes of blocked sewer drains across Cheltenham and Melbourne’s Bayside suburbs. Older clay and earthenware pipes commonly develop small cracks or loose joints over time. What to Do If a Sewer Blockage Is in a South East Water Asset

If a sewer blockage is found to be located in South East Water’s asset—typically outside your property boundary and within the main public sewer—then it is not your responsibility to repair. Understanding the Legal Point of Discharge in Stormwater Drains in Bayside Melbourne

When it comes to stormwater drainage, understanding the legal point of discharge is crucial for homeowners and businesses in Bayside Melbourne. The “legal point of discharge” refers to the location where stormwater from a property can legally be discharged into the public stormwater system.
